Malaika Arora Khan, known for her dance moves in popular Bollywood songs like 'Chhaiya chhaiya' and 'Mahi ve', has been a part of quite a few small screen reality shows and she admits that she is more inclined to television.

'The small screen today is tomorrow's big screen, ' Malaika said here at the launch of new dance reality show 'Zara Nachke Dikha'.

Malaika is the judge for the show to be aired on STAR One starting July 14.

'I have always been a TV person. I don't do much on big screen apart from songs, ' she said.

The dance show apart, Malaika is now all set for her first full-length role as an actress opposite Arjun Rampal in Suniel Shetty's 'EMI'.
